On 2/15/11 11:23 PM, Dan Davison wrote:
Commit ed6d6760268 removed variables htmlp and latexp from
`org-export-preprocess-string'. Nothing wrong with that, but I think it
has broken export for those using org-special-blocks
Confirmed. Exporting the following example stops with a void-variable
